downstate
Downstate means belonging or relating to the parts of a state that are furthest to the south. downstate in American English in, to, or from downstate that part of a state farther to the south adjective: located in or characteristic of this part adverb: in, to, or into the downstate area noun: the southern part of a U.S. state downstate in British English adjective: in, or relating to the part of the state away from large cities, esp the southern part adverb: towards the southern part of a state noun: the southern part of a state |
